ING

ING Stock Warning: Why Analysts See -10% Downside Risk

  • ING wrapped up a share repurchase for employee compensation on March 3, buying back 2.97 million shares at €23.82 average, fulfilling obligations under its share-based plans.
  • Ongoing main buyback advanced to 76.97% complete by March 10, with 35.8 million shares acquired at €23.62 average, underscoring commitment to returning capital amid stable operations.
  • Q1 2025 showed weaker net income from higher expenses and lower NII due to ECB rate cuts, raising analyst worries about profitability sustainability in a low-rate environment.

Pros

  • ING Groep demonstrated strong financial performance in Q3 2025, with significant growth in net interest income and fee income, lifting net profit to €6 billion over the past four quarters.
  • The bank upgraded its full-year return on equity outlook to over 12.5%, reflecting improving profitability and operational efficiency.
  • ING has launched an AI chatbot across six markets, showing its commitment to technological innovation and sustainable finance volumes increased by 29% year-on-year.

Considerations

  • Despite strong performance, ING Groep scores only 2 out of 6 on valuation checks, indicating potential concerns regarding current share price sustainability or overvaluation.
  • The European Central Bank’s 2025 Supervisory Review increased ING’s capital requirements, including a higher CET1 and leverage ratio, which may pressure capital allocation and future returns.
  • Although the loan book is expanding, there is exposure to economic cyclicality and regulatory risks inherent in European banking regulation and macroeconomic conditions.

ING (ING) Next Earnings Date

ING Group's next earnings date is estimated for April 30, 2026, covering the first quarter of 2026 (Q1 2026). This aligns with the company's historical pattern of late-April releases for Q1 results, as seen in prior years and confirmed by recent investor updates following the Q4/FY2025 report in January 2026. Some estimates point to April 29 or May 1, but official indications favor end-April. Investors should monitor ING's investor relations calendar for any confirmations.
